Abstract
Various embodiments of the present technology may provide methods and apparatus for cleaning a source vessel. The source vessel may be filled or partially filled with a solvent to form a solution. The solution is removed from the source vessel and contained in a waste vessel that is connected to the source vessel. The waste vessel may have a bellow or other mechanism inside of it to create a negative pressure in the waste vessel to pull the solution out of the source vessel and into the waste vessel. Alternatively, a liquid pump may be used to pull the solution from the source vessel to the waste vessel.
